Executive summary:

A test was conducted on methyl benzoate to assess its eye irritating potential to rabbits' eyes. Three New Zealand White rabbits were used. The study was performed in accordance to GLP and OECD Guideline 405. After a single application of 0.1 mL methyl benzoate, the animals were observed for a period of 7 days and eye reactions were recorded at 1, 24, 48 and 71 hours. The mean scores for cornea opacity calculated for the time points 24, 48 and 72 hours were 0, 0, 0 for animal1, 2 and 3, respectively. Iris mean scores were 0, 0, 0 as well. The conjunctiva scores were calculated to be 0.67, 0.67, 0.67 and chemosis scores were 0.67, 0.67 and 0. All findings were reversible within 72 hours. On the basis of these results, the substance is considered to be non irritating to the rabbits' eyes.
